Jump to content
Search In
  • More options...
Find results that contain...
Find results in...

Moonwalker

Users
  
  • Posts

    398
  • Joined

  • Last visited

Everything posted by Moonwalker

  1. Да, забыл версию написать. Спасибо огромное, все заработало! Несколько расширит возможности отображения товаров на сайте без двусмысленностей ))
  2. В 1.5.5.1 не сработало )) Видимо, немного другая конструкция if должна быть. За задание направления спасибо, пойду курить мануалы ))
  3. Ситуация следующая. Есть товар, у него есть опции (необязательные), что-то вроде "Дополнения к товару". Могут отсутствовать в наличии, но при этом сам товар есть. Если у товара стоит количество, допустим, 10, а у всех возможнных опций - 0, то в карточке товара в месте, где выводятся опции, показывается "Дополнения к товару:", при этом, соответственно, никаких дополнений внизу выбрать невозможно, поскольку у всех опций количество 0 и они не выводятся. Вопрос в том, какой if прописать в карточку товара, чтобы в случае, если сумма всех опций >0, то вот этот заголовок "Дополнения к товару:" выводится, а если нет, то не выводится. Ибо только мешает и смущает покупателей ))
  4. Удалось найти исполнителя? В принципе, похожая проблема. Есть несколько вещей, которые надо допилить (касаются вывода в симпле (ocStore 1.5.5.1.2 и simple 4.7.7) и попадания заказа в админку). Если есть, кто готов взяться (сам модуль лежит тут - http://shop-logistics.ru/cmsmodules/detail.php?ID=23057), пишите в личку, опишу задачу, дам код для виджета для тестов, чтобы оценить объем и стоимость работы. По ощущениям, там работы на пару часов максимум опытному человеку, а то и меньше.
  5. Всем привет. Один из основных инструментов для обновления остатков и добавления новых товаров. Пользуюсь много лет, причем, до сих пор сижу на весьма старой версии 3.3.0. Работает, и главное, не люблю без надобности менять то, что и так дает результат )) Но возник тут вопрос. Возможно, как-то изменилась схема работы или появилось решение. Вопрос по опциям. В частности, при обновлении товара с опциями получается, что старые опции у товара удаляются, а на их месте создаются новые с новыми product_option_id и product_option_value_id. Это до сих пор так? Просто хочется тут кое-какие вещи еще автоматизировать, а при постоянном затирании старых и создании новых опций это будет нереально =/ Или в новых версиях модуля уже другая схема работы с опциями? ps. К слову, из-за этого же периодически возникает проблема с Яндекс.Маркетом, когда параметр в ссылке ведет на старую опцию, а в товаре уже новая (генерим по крону, поскольку товаров много). В итоге неверная цена и ошибка от Маркета с понижением рейтинга ))
  6. Блин, оба круты, спасибо ))) Осталось только под 1.5 реализовать, но уже сам покопаюсь, главное, понять, к какому array прицепиться ))
  7. День добрый! Может, кто сталкивался или реализовывал )) Понадобилась одна штука, покопался, не нашел, как реализовать. В админке при просмотре заказа в таблице выводится количество товаров непосредственно в заказе. Хочу дополнительно в эту же табличку вывести текущее количество каждого товара из заказа (для того, чтобы не прыгать и не смотреть, сколько осталось, чтобы прямо в заказе было видно, последний он был, если, например, осталось 0, или, наоборот, с запасом). Всякие дополнительные sku, isbn, jan и прочее выводятся без проблем. А вот текущее число что-то туплю и не пойму, как вывести =/ При этом мне не нужно это число привязывать к заказу, создавая дополнительную ячейку в бд, просто при просмотре списка товаров в заказе актуальные остатки по данным товарам подгружаются. Понимаю, что надо в контроллер order.php (там потенциально три блока, куда надо воткнуть) и потом в order_info.tpl добавить, но что именно - не хватает знаний )) Может, кто ткнет носом? )) Заранее спасибо.
  8. Есть задача "раздать слонов". Условно, начислить на бонусный счет всем зарегистрированным пользователям по 100 бонусных баллов. Как это проще всего реализовать? Может, есть модуль какой-нибудь для массового управлениями бонусными баллами? Или проще каким-нибудь SQL запросом сделать (рассылку потом сам могу сделать, главное - начислить)? Может, кто-нибудь подскажет решение? зы. ocStore 1.5.5.1.2
  9. Базовая возможность неудобна, условно, по паре причин. Во-первых, необходимость логиниться. Во-вторых, необходимость регистрироваться в принципе. А так человек зашел, указал почту при оформлении заказа, оплатил, получил на почту ссылку. По юрикам пока неактуально в принципе, надо сперва потестить. Просто изменения все с онлайн.кассами малек внесли коррективы, поэтому надо смотреть, кто сейчас удобен в плане работы )) Надо в сторону Яндекс.Кассы глянуть, только для физиков. Принимали как юрлицо через них платежи на сайте, было удобно.
  10. Нашел несколько попыток разобраться в вопросе, но окончательного ответа так и не нашел )) Посему попробую еще раз )) Задача: реализовать продажу цифровых товаров. Клиент сразу после оплаты получает ссылку на скачивание. Крайне желательно, чтобы получал не только возможность скачать из личного кабинета (еще вопрос, получится ли), но и письмом на почту. Сам "товар", скорее всего, будет вообще на удаленном сервере или в облаке, поэтому клиенту нужно отдавать именно ссылку. В самом плохом варианте, в каком-нибудь текстовом файле, например. Чем реализовать можно, кто подскажет? Пока в голову приходят только модули для продажи серийников, вместо которых, по сути, ссылки и отдавать клиенту. Ну и второй вопрос, чтобы темы не плодить... Чем удобнее всего реализовать прием платежей? Не хочется на время тестов официально заморачиваться, поэтому нужен какой-нибудь агрегатор, который позволит принимать платежи любым способом (от карты до вебмани), а потом даст возможность полученные деньги вывести на карту или какой-нибудь электронный кошелек. Желательно, чтобы была возможность снятия комиссии "с меня", а не клиента. Т.е., если товар стоит 1000 рублей, клиент платил именно 1000. Ну и, конечно, нужен модуль для приема, который после оплаты заказу и статус будет менять на "Оплачено". Заранее спасибо за ответы ))
  11. Grembl, как успехи-то? Предстоит подобная задача. С категориями/товарами худо-бедно разберусь, хоть и не без поллитры и кучи редиректов... А вот возможность перенести покупателей (с паролями) и заказы весьма интересует (пусть у заказов и связи с реальными товарами на новой площадке не будет, хотя бы названия товаров в заказах и стоимость/итого сохранить бы). Кто-нибудь решал? Или копать в сторону этих модулей/сервисов? И интересно, в каком-то более-менее автоматическом режиме есть возможность при таком переносе все редиректы настроить? Ибо структура вообще другая, да еще и категории с .html в конце )) Да и вообще там по урлам такой бардак, что грустно становится )) Переносить надо на ocStore. Главные категории потом руками сделаем, если что. Просто нужны советы )) ps. Товаров около 16 тысяч (схема дебильная, там часть товаров - типа заведены, но как опции других). Заказов около 4 тысяч. Покупателей где-то тоже около 3,5 тысяч.
  12. Дурацкий вопрос. Ни у кого на сайте Admin Quick Edit не стоит? Со старой версией все работало, решил тут обновиться, судя по всему, какой-то конфликт и перестало искать =/ Причем, на странице с заказами AQE выключен, но что-то, судя по всему, все равно подгружает, в итоге видимость поиска есть, а по факту все равно все заказы показывает =/
  13. Так мне казалось, я не в ветке 2.х спрашивал ))) Там свои "Общие вопросы" )) Да, этот вариант работает )) Благодарствую. Жалко, лишь один плюсик можно поставить в карму. С меня пузырь
  14. Хм, видимо, забыл уточнить версию. У меня ocStore 1.5.5.1 Там, видать, логика малек иначе. Ладно, будем копать. Не сказать, что прям критично надо, но уже даче чисто спортивный интерес появился ))
  15. Первый кусок ты в каком файле в какое место вставляешь?
  16. Notice: Undefined variable: mydatab in... ((( Может, критично, куда в контроллере вставлять?
  17. Дурацкий вопрос: а важно, в каком месте контроллера header.php прописывать? Потому как в месте, где вывожу <?php echo $mydata; ?> показывает Notice: Undefined variable: mydata in ... В контроллер воткнуто это: $mydata = $this->db->query("SELECT * FROM oc_aaa"); По запросу SELECT * FROM oc_aaa извне получаю нужные данные, которые записаны в ячейке. Чую, что где-то близко, а попасть не могу )) Такое ощущение, что запрос к бд нужно все-таки куда-то в модель воткнуть, а в контроллере просто обработать.
  18. Это, насколько я понимаю, уже в controller/common/header.php можно прописать? Минуя какой-либо model? А потом через echo в header.tpl вывести?
  19. Бд - та же самая, в которой магазин. Просто еще одна таблица, или даже строка в какой-нить имеющейся (еще не решил). Допустим, в БД магазина таблица "oc_updatedate", в ней один столбец и одна строка. В ней данные, которые надо выводить.Тип данных - короткий текст. Можно тот же varchar. А какие еще детали нужны? Имя таблицы, столбца, ячейки? Условно, мне нужно из той же самой базы взять данные и вывести их в админке в шапке. Ну и я не просил никого готовое решение бесплатно ваять )) Скорее, попросил дать направление. Допустим, можно было задать задачу так: мне нужно в шапке в админке вывести название магазина (оно же, по сути, в той же бд хранится в определенной ячейке). А дальше по схеме уже просто беру данные из другой ячейки для вывода )) Или факс из настроек магазина, все равно не используется. Могу прямо туда нужные данные записывать. За наводку на материал по созданию модулей спасибо. Но я особо модули не собирался писать, мне просто надо уже имеющиеся в бд данные вывести, протащив через controller и model, судя по всему ))
  20. Добрый день, сообщество! Необходимо реализовать вывод в шапку админки (куда именно воткнуть - пока не решил, но проблема не в этом) данные из определенной ячейки БД магазина. При обновлении остатков (запросом в бд извне) в эту ячейку записывается текущая дата и время. Соответственно, нужно взять эти данные и вывести в шапку админки сайта, чтобы можно было всегда видеть актуальность данных. В БД еще ничего не создавал, поэтому есть варианты и отдельную таблицу с одним столбцом и одной строкой под эти данные сделать, и в какую-нибудь oc_setting засунуть (хотя, кажись, отдельная во избежание накладок будет логичнее). Понимаю, что нужно править какой-то model (либо создавать отдельный), где делать запрос в БД для получения данных ячейки, затем править контроллер header.php и, соответственно, выводить в header.tpl. Логику понимаю, но навыков для создания правильной таблицы, формирования нужных запросов в модели и их обработки в контроллере, не хватает (( С записью даты и времени в бд как-раз проблем нет )) Кто-нибудь направит на путь истинный?
  21. Прикупил, блин ))) Все письма, все уведомления от всех работающих в магазине модулей отправляются через настроенный красивый шаблон письма (реализован сторонним модулем), а тут где-то откопал базовый опенкартовский текстовый шаблон и шлет через него =/ В таблице отсутствуют товары )) Заголовок таблички, а дальше сумма, доставка и итого )) оцСтор 1.5.5.1.2 В общем, не денег жалко. Просто вот так вот получается ))) ps. Забавно было в vqmod'e увидеть прямую ссылку на отправку через демосайт автора ))
  22. Поддерживаю тех, кто просил добавить возможность при клике из заказа искать без первой цифры (народ то с 8, то с +7 начинает)... Либо скажите, что где поправить, сами сделаем )) Понятно, что потом можно поправить и искать заново, но это лишние действия =/
  23. Кто-нибудь с Journal его дружил? Не только не хочет "всплывать", но даже блокирует добавление заказов в корзину... Привык уже к нему просто, везде ставлю )) А тут неожиданность ))
×
×
  • Create New...

Important Information

On our site, cookies are used and personal data is processed to improve the user interface. To find out what and what personal data we are processing, please go to the link. If you click "I agree," it means that you understand and accept all the conditions specified in this Privacy Notice.